Kirtland Community College Foundation
|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net | Reserve mo. | Staff % |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2012 | 170,431 | 142,873 | 27,558 | 107.5 | 0% |
| 2013 | 260,425 | 171,361 | 89,064 | 95.8 | 0% |
| 2014 | 65,708 | 98,454 | −32,746 | 202.3 | 0% |
| 2015 | 186,462 | 93,454 | 93,008 | 223.1 | 0% |
| 2016 | 499,363 | 200,160 | 299,203 | 122.5 | 0% |
| 2017 | 51,080 | 188,410 | −137,330 | 130.8 | 0% |
| 2018 | 47,509 | 159,036 | −111,527 | 153.7 | 0% |
| 2019 | 98,741 | 120,083 | −21,342 | 205.4 | 0% |
| 2020 | 186,547 | 134,567 | 51,980 | 186.5 | 0% |
| 2021 | 259,294 | 95,401 | 163,893 | 348.0 | 0% |
| 2022 | 315,733 | 122,003 | 193,730 | 256.3 | 0% |
| 2023 | 113,125 | 152,790 | −39,665 | 216.8 | 0% |
In its most recent public year (2023), this organization spent $39,665 more than it brought in. Its reserves stood at about 216.8 months of spending, up from 107.5 in 2012. Staff pay was 0% of spending. $2,379,164 of its net assets are donor-restricted.
Reserve months = net assets ÷ average monthly spending; net assets count everything the organization owns beyond its debts — buildings and donor-restricted funds included, not just cash. Staff pay = salaries, wages, and officer compensation; it excludes benefits and payroll taxes. The IRS releases this data years after the fact — this organization's newest public year is 2023.
